Background technology
Negative pressure wound therapy instrument be usually used to treatment patient body on open wound, by wound apply can The reduction pressure or vacuum of control help to cure wound to promote cell migration and possible juice to evacuate.Negative pressure wound is controlled Treat instrument and generally comprise coating and vacuum system, the coating is applied to be formed the airtight barrier of covering wound, the vacuum system It is adapted to connect on coating, so as to which when wound is coated to cap rock covering, the pressure of reduction is generated on wound.
But existing negative pressure wound therapy instrument is over the course for the treatment of, because wound is opened, when carrying out negative pressure adjustment, newly The gas of introducing easily causes wound infection and causes secondary insult.

A kind of multi-functional wound treatment apparatus, including:Ozone sensor for detecting wound ozone content;For examining Survey the baroceptor of wound air pressure;Vavuum pump for reducing wound air pressure;Ozone preparing device for preparing ozone; Ozone for prepared by ozone preparing device is released to wound or stops the valve of release ozone;For containing in wound ozone Amount opens the control module of ozone sensor and valve when being less than threshold value;The air pressure that the control module is additionally operable in wound is high Vavuum pump is opened when threshold value, and vavuum pump is closed when the air pressure of wound is less than threshold value.
In the prior art, negative pressure wound therapy instrument over the course for the treatment of, due to wound open, carry out negative pressure adjustment when, The gas newly introduced easily causes wound infection and causes secondary insult.When the present invention is applied, ozone sensor detection wound Locate ozone content, baroceptor detection wound air pressure, vavuum pump reduction wound air pressure, ozone preparing device prepares ozone, Ozone prepared by ozone preparing device is released to wound or stops release ozone by valve, and control module is in wound ozone content Ozone sensor and valve are opened during less than threshold value, control module is additionally operable to open vacuum when the air pressure of wound is higher than threshold value Pump, and close vavuum pump when the air pressure of wound is less than threshold value.Hinder because ozone preparing device prepares ozone and reached by valve At mouthful, so as to be sterilized to wound, and then wound is caused not cause secondary insult because of infection, while passing through control Module controls miscellaneous part coordinate operation, realizes the intelligent control of the present apparatus.
Further, the air pressure of the wound is higher than threshold value, and the threshold value is set below 45~55mmHg of atmospheric pressure.
Further, the air pressure of the wound be less than threshold value, the threshold value be set below atmospheric pressure 200~ 250mmHg。
When the present invention is applied, inventor is had found, when the air pressure of wound is 45~250mmHg, the pressure of wound is expired The premise of sufficient negative pressure treatment, while ozone concentration can also reach sterilization standard.
Further, the valve is connected to wound by humidification bottle.
Further, wound is additionally provided with catheter.
Because there is negative pressure wound, so wound can be caused to have liquid to ooze out, in the prior art, due to can not be to wound Place carries out disinfection, so these liquid are drawn using gauze etc., and gauze etc. needs frequently to be changed, so as to hold very much Easily occurs secondary pollution.When the present invention is applied, due to having carried out real-time sterilization in wound, so as to use catheter to wound Liquid assimilating is carried out at mouthful, even if backflow or gas leakage occur for catheter, will not also occur wound infection.
